LESSON PLAN

Subject : Mathematics year 4


Topic : Volume of liquid
Learning Objective : Pupils will be taught to multiply and divide
units of volume.
Learning Area : Basic operations involving volume of liquid.
Learning Outcomes: Pupils will be able to solve problems involving
volume of liquids.
Resources : mineral bottle,flash cards, measuring jug,
measuring cyclinder, beaker, worksheet.
Moral values : Confidentinal,honest.

Activities :
Step 1 : Solve problem involving volume of liquids in ml.

Step 2 : Select problems according to pupils ability.

Step 3 : Solve problem involving volume of liquids.

Three pupils to come forward.
Each of them takes one mineral bottle.
The pupils read the volume of water in the bottle.
Pupils say the total amount of water in the bottle.
Teacher introduces the number sentence ( horizontal form ) of
multiplication.
500ml 500ml 500ml

3 x 500 ml = 1500 ml
multiplication
Solve problem involving volume of liquid in and m .
Ali drinks 5 cups of coffee a day. Each cup contains 0.2 . How much
coffee does Ali drink in one day?
0.2 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.2
5 0.2

1


Solve problem involving volume of liquid in litre.

A bottle of milk contains 1.5 litres of milk.

Ah Chong bought 6 bottles of milk.

What is the total volume of milk did he buy?
6 x 1.5 = 9
